Digital Technology Specialist - Data Science

6225 Baker Hughes Saudi Arabia Company · Saudi Arabia

our organization increasingly adopts AI-enabled and agentic ways of working, we are looking for individuals who combine strong scientific and engineering fundamentals with curiosity, adaptability, and a bias for execution. Success in this role requires the ability to rapidly learn emerging technologies, collaborate across disciplines, and contribute throughout the entire solution lifecycle from problem framing and experimentation through deployment, operationalization, and continuous improvement.

Experience in Oil & Gas and an appreciation for the importance of domain context in solving real business problems are highly valued.

As a Digital Technology Specialist, you will be responsible for

  • Identify, frame, and solve complex business and operational challenges using data science, machine learning, AI, optimization, and software engineering techniques.
  • Design, develop, test, deploy, and maintain end-to-end data and AI solutions that create measurable business impact.
  • Translate analytical concepts into scalable, reliable, and maintainable production systems.
  • Contribute across the full solution lifecycle, including requirements discovery, experimentation, development, deployment, monitoring, and continuous improvement.
  • Collaborate with domain experts to incorporate operational context and business constraints into solution design.
  • Leverage modern AI-assisted development practices and emerging technologies to accelerate delivery while maintaining engineering rigor, quality, and governance.
  • Work closely with data engineers and platform teams to ensure data quality, reliability, scalability, and observability.
  • Evaluate new technologies, frameworks, and methodologies, adopting them where they provide meaningful business value.
  • Communicate technical findings and recommendations effectively to both technical and non-technical stakeholders.
  • Contribute actively within Agile teams operating across multiple locations, functions, and time zones.
  • Document, share, and promote best practices that improve team effectiveness and technical excellence.

To be successful in this role you will

  • Have a bachelor's degree in computer science, Data Science, Engineering, Mathematics, Physics, Information Systems, or another STEM discipline.
  • Have a minimum 4 years of professional experience in data science, machine learning, analytics, software engineering, or a closely related technical field.
  • Demonstrated experience delivering solutions from concept through production deployment.
  • Have a strong programming and software engineering fundamentals.
  • Proven ability to learn and apply new technologies, frameworks, and methodologies in rapidly evolving environments.

Technical Expertise

  • Strong proficiency in Python and experience developing production-quality software.
  • Experience with modern development ecosystems and cloud-native technologies, such as:
  • Python
  • TypeScript
  • Go and/or Rust
  • AWS
  • Databricks
  • Git-based CI/CD pipelines
  • Containerization technologies such as Docker and Kubernetes
  • Experience with machine learning, AI, optimization, statistical analysis, and data-driven decision-making.
  • Familiarity with large language models (LLMs), generative AI, agentic systems, and AI application development.
  • Understanding of software architecture, testing, deployment, monitoring, and operational excellence.
  • Experience working with structured, semi-structured, and time-series industrial data.
  • Strong data visualization, storytelling, and stakeholder communication skills.

Domain Knowledge

  • Experience in Oil & Gas, energy, industrial operations, manufacturing, or related sectors is strongly preferred.
  • Ability to combine domain understanding with analytical and engineering expertise to solve practical business problems.
  • Understanding of operational workflows, reliability, production optimization, asset performance, or related industrial challenges is advantageous.
